Pantomime Theatre to start season with “Mankurt”
By Nigar Orujova
Azerbaijan is a country with profound theater life. It can always offer theater lovers some places to go.
However, the main problem is that most plays are not staged in English. But, don't worry because you can always delight yourself with a theater understandable around the world: pantomime.
Pantomime is considered to be the most international art, anyone can understand the plot through the facial expressions and gestures of mime. But at the same time, this theater has its own peculiarity in different countries.
The repertoire of the Pantomime Theatre in Baku includes more than 20 productions in various genres of drama and comedy, from Azerbaijan and abroad.
The inimitable plastic art of the theater actors, precise movements and unique adaptations make the theater the very famous place around the local theater amateurs.
The newly renovated theater of pantomime in Baku will start the season with a play called "Mankurt" on September 20.
The play is based on the works of the famous Kyrgyz writer Chinghiz Aitmatov "The Day Lasts More Than a Hundred Years."
The play is directed by Jeyhun Dadashov, with artist Sanubar Samedova, musical arrangement by Elman Rafiyev and director for choreography Bakhtiar Khanizade.
This performance has been staged by the theater for years. However, in the new season, it will be presented in a new interpretation.
All the actors of the theater are engaged in this performance.
